3D Printing in Oral Surgery
To boost the field of oral surgery, you can discover the subtopic of 3D printing in dental surgery. This cutting-edge technology has the prospective to reinvent the means oral doctors run and treat patients. Right here are four crucial ways in which 3D printing is shaping the area:
- ** Personalized Surgical Guides **: 3D printing enables the creation of highly accurate and patient-specific surgical guides, boosting the accuracy and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, dental doctors can develop tailored implant prosthetics that completely fit a client's special composition, causing much better results and client contentment.
-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, reducing the requirement for standard implanting strategies and boosting recovery and recuperation time.
- ** Education and Training **: 3D printing can be used to create sensible medical designs for academic objectives, allowing oral surgeons to practice intricate treatments prior to performing them on individuals.
With its potential to improve precision, modification, and training, 3D printing is an amazing growth in the field of dental surgery.
Minimally Invasive Methods
To better progress the area of dental surgery, accept the possibility of minimally intrusive techniques that can greatly benefit both specialists and people alike.
Minimally invasive techniques are changing the area by lowering surgical trauma, minimizing post-operative discomfort, and increasing the recovery process. These strategies involve using smaller sized lacerations and specialized instruments to perform procedures with precision and efficiency.
By making use of sophisticated imaging modern technology, such as cone beam of light calculated tomography (CBCT), surgeons can accurately intend and execute surgeries with very little invasiveness.
Furthermore, making use of lasers in dental surgery enables exact tissue cutting and coagulation, leading to lessened blood loss and minimized healing time.
With minimally invasive strategies, patients can experience much faster recovery, minimized scarring, and enhanced results, making it a crucial facet of the future of dental surgery.
